Boil water advisory in effect for parts of Elizabethtown

ELIZABETHTOWN, NC (WECT) – A precautionary boil water advisory is currently in effect for parts of Elizabethtown, according to town officials.

The advisory, issued Wednesday, covers South Poplar Street from Swanzy Street to Dunham Street, and South Poplar Street to Mercer Mill Road at Elizabeth Street.

A water main break prompted the advisory, and workers are currently trying fix the problem as soon as possible.

ECU dental center could be coming to Columbus, Brunswick or Bladen Co.

SOUTHEASTERN NC (WECT) – East Carolina University leaders are considering opening a dental community learning center in Southeastern NC.

According to Kim Smith, the health director at ECU, the university is considering putting a center in either Columbus, Bladen, or Brunswick counties.

Smith says that whichever county ECU ends up choosing, the school will pay for the building, but the county must donate two acres of land.

Bladen We Care receives $1,000 donation

BLADEN COUNTY, NC (WECT) – Bladen We Care recently received a $1,000 gift from Cape Fear Farm Credit, according to Bladen Online.

Bladen We Care is a non-profit organization that raises and oversees the distribution of funds to provide healthcare assistance to patients in need in Bladen County.

The secretary for Bladen We Care told Bladen Online the organization is on track to spend about $50,000 this year. All of the money they collect goes directly back into the hands of the people who need assistance.

Bladen County drops in state health rankings

BLADEN COUNTY, NC (WECT) – The Robert Wood Johnson Foundation released its 2012 health rankings for North Carolina and the results are not good for Bladen County.

Bladen County weighs in at number 97 in the list, falling one place from its 96th ranking in 2011.

The report is based on several factors, including lifespan, exercise habits, medical access and similar factors. 

The poor ranking in Bladen County is based in part on obesity, premature deaths and physical inactivity.

Cafeterias earn Golden A award

BLADEN COUNTY, NC (WECT) – Bladen County School’s cafeteria managers have been awarded the Golden A for operating first-rate cafeterias, according to the school system’s website.

The Bladen County Health Department Board of Health presented all thirteen school cafeterias with the honor.

According to Bladen County schools, a school cafeteria must score a grade of 97 or above on each inspection made between July 1, 2011 and June 30, 2012.

This is the third year in a row the school cafeterias have received the Golden A award.
